Subject: spare parts run to Kestrel Ridge

Hi dispatch,

The pump seals and the two controller boards for the Kestrel Ridge station finally turned up from Obritek. They're boxed and labelled on the blue shelf by my office — please don't split the shipment, the site crew needs everything in one go. Weather window is Tuesday, so book the early run. The boards are fragile, keep them top of the load. When the courier checks in, pass along the hand-over instruction below.

courier memo of tawep-tajep: the quenius ulaiel courier leaves the fenir ledger at gate 9128 under passcode 527513

- [ ] Step 7: Archive cold storage buckets (Glacierline tier). Confirm both ceremony witnesses are present, verify bucket manifests match the Oxbow ledger, then seal the archive key shares. Plugin authors may observe but not handle shares. Once sealed, the archive index itself is encrypted and can only be reopened with the passphrase below.

vault phrase of badup-hahig = tamael-aldael-kelmir-istael-fenok-istwyn-tamius-jorath-oliion

Their Pathfinder product line complements our Merrow platform, and engineering assesses integration effort as moderate. Financially, Tollam shows steady revenue but thin margins, largely due to a single-source component contract we would renegotiate. Cultural fit interviews were broadly positive, though retention packages for key staff remain unresolved. We recommend proceeding to a non-binding offer. The valuation range reflects the confidential considerations recorded below.

internal memo for yahag-tahog: The pricing group signed off on a budget of $152.8 million for Project Soriel.